Wills in Kansas and Missouri

A will, also called a last will and testament, is one of the most important documents in your estate plan. It allows you to clearly state how your assets should be distributed, who should care for your minor children, and who will manage your estate after your passing.

It’s important to understand that a will generally must go through probate, the legal process through which a court oversees the distribution of your assets. While probate can take time and may involve additional costs, a properly drafted will still provides essential guidance, ensures your wishes are legally recognized, and helps protect your loved ones during a difficult time.

Why a Will Is Important

A will allows you to:

  • Choose who receives your assets
  • Appoint guardians for minor children
  • Name an executor to manage your estate
  • Prevent family disputes and misunderstandings
  • Provide clarity and direction to your loved ones

Even though a will goes through probate, it is a critical tool in your estate planning toolbox, ensuring your intentions are honored and giving your family peace of mind.

What a Will Can Cover

A thoughtfully drafted will may include:

  • Distribution of property, financial accounts, and personal belongings
  • Guardianship arrangements for children
  • Instructions for personal or sentimental items
  • Special bequests or charitable gifts
